Section 39-22-106 - Colorado personal exemptions of a resident individual

A resident individual shall be entitled to a Colorado exemption of zero dollars.L. 87: Entire part R&RE, p. 1430, § 2, effective June 22.This section is similar to former § 39-22-114 as it existed prior to 1987.
